03/17/2010 - Newark, NJ (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- Seton Hall has reportedly fired head men's basketball coach Bobby Gonzalez.
The Star-Ledger reported that on Wednesday, the school forced out Gonzalez, who was in his fourth season with the team. The paper cited two people with knowledge of the process, who told the paper he was forced out not because of results, but because of behavior on and off the court.
The news comes just a day after the Pirates had their season end in the first round of the NIT, in an 87-69 loss to Texas Tech. In that game, Seton Hall's Herb Pope was ejected after punching an opposing player below the belt. Gonzalez was also later issued a technical foul in the contest.
Additionally, late on Sunday, forward Robert Mitchell was removed from the basketball team for unspecified reasons.
Back in September, Gonzalez was given a contract extension to remain with the school through the 2014-15 season.
